Ideal for enviroments that are exposed to cold temperatures:

  • temporary / mobile traffic lights
  • mobile security
  • power in your shed or garage - unheated property
  • power in your vehicle / boat that is left frequently in cold environments (North Europe). If boat is left unoccupied in a Marina during cold seasons, for example.
  • works vehicles where rear area is prone to sub zero temps

Where heated batteries are possibly unnecesarry:

  • live on board vehicles, typically no area gets to subzero temperatures
  • frequently used RV / campervans. Unlikely temperatures reach subzero

Lithium Iron Phosphate cells should be above 0DegC when charging. The heater uses your charger power to warm the battery up to +5DegC - if the battery was at 0DegC or lower. Discharging your battery is okay down to -20DegC.

The LH series use a JBD BMS with Bluetooth and heating elements:

LH12100 - 50W - JBD-DP04S007-L4S-100A

LH12200 - 100W - JBD-DP04S007-L4S-200A

The heating element

These elements require at least this power to warm the battery - please ensure your battery charger / DC DC charger is powerful enough to engage the heating element. The heater comes on provided the cells temperature is at 0DegC or lower AND there is 50W | 100W of available power. Once the temperature hits 5DegC, the charge circuit engages to allow for charging current to flow into the battery. The heating element shall remain on until the battery temperature hits 15DegC. Therefore, for a period of time, some charge current shall be going into warming your cells up further and some charge current shall be passing into the lithium battery. Once 15DegC is met, the heating element turns off and all charging current goes into the battery. This resets the temperature based activation.

Advise on battery charger power selection for the LH series - minimum recommended:

LH12100 x1 = 100W+ battery charger
LH12200 x1 = 200W+ battery charger
LH12100 x2 = 200W+ battery charger
LH12200 x2 = 400W+ battery charger

If multiple LH batteries are installed in a setup please remember that the power required to activate the heater is cumulative. For a setup involving 2x LH12100 - you shall require at least 100W of usable DC power to simply run the heaters. 100W shall simply be used to warm the batteries up. So, we recommend 200W+ of charger to actually enable charging when the 5DegC temperature is reached.
